Block

#21,423,785
Block Number
21,423,785 @ 04/16/2025, 01:29:20
Status
Finalized
ID
0x0146e6a98c895d077c8df9a84569ccba58c5b1e4937d13babb9192be8f5e90f4
Transactions
Gas Used
4501026/40000000 (11.25% Used)
Total Score
2,091,972,583 (+99)
Rewards
16.65 VTHO